AUTHORIZATION AGREEMENT FOR ELECTRONIC FUNDS TRANSFER PAYMENTS
In accordance with the Debt Collection Improvement Act of 1996 (Public Law 104-134), the National Credit Union
Administration (NCUA) must make payments to credit unions by Electronic Funds Transfer (EFT).

PART II – OPTIONAL
As a convenience to credit unions, NCUA is now using a Treasury-developed program, Pay.Gov, to accept
electronic credit union payments to NCUA via direct debit on the invoice due date using the account info above.
If you do not elect Pay.Gov as a method of payment to NCUA, you must pay NCUA invoices by check.

Yes, please direct debit my credit union’s invoiced amounts through Pay.Gov.
